BTW Nick gave the legalistic reason that POI commiters are required to
swear that they have never been bound by an exclusionary
agreement with Microsoft regarding these file formats. (He was slightly
inaccurate in his version as we don't require you to never have SEEN the
specs because some were/are released publically w/o restriction, we've
never used the word sign without "sign or been bound by" as
employer/member agreements can be binding w/o you signing it)
